Line Driver - Forklift

Duties And Responsibilities
- Operates machinery of assigned department to complete assigned work
- Receives and reviews work
- Communicates the required amount of material needed to perform tasks to other
- Continuous observation of machine operation to ensure optimal performance of standard work within assigned department
- Performs hazard-based functions on machinery, including lock out/tag out and daily equipment
- Stacks, sorts, and bundles material according to assigned department’s standard
- Achieves production goals while complying with all safety
- Accomplishes quality checks to verify proper parameters are adhered
- Assists with quality checks to verify proper parameters are adhered
- Assists Operators II & III on packaging and end-of-line work, and as needed
Knowledge/Skills/Abilities
- Highly motivated with a good, sound work ethic
- Must demonstrate safe working practices and possess great attention to detail
- Good communication, organization, and time management skills
- Basic computer, mathematics, and problem-solving skills
- Ability to use a calculator, measuring devices (gauges, tapes, rulers)
- Team player able to follow instructions from both management and peers
- Ability to learn and operate new equipment
Education And Experience
- High School Diploma or GED preferred
- At least 18 years of age
- Prior experience in a manufacturing setting
Working Conditions
- Fast-paced manufacturing environment
- Exposure to both ambient/outside temperatures and dust
- Working with mechanical parts and pinch points
- Exposure to increased noise levels
Physical Requirements
- OCCASIONALLY: Lifting or carrying up to 10 lbs
- FREQUENTLY: Lifting or carrying up to 40 lbs
- CONTINUOUSLY: Bending or stooping, reaching above shoulder level, pushing/pulling up to 50 lbs, standing, sitting, walking, repetitive motion including wrists, hands, and fingers, vision, hearing, dexterity, hand-eye coordination, use of personal protective equipment (eye and hearing protection, safety toe shoes, hi-vis vests)

Note To Washington Applicants
Per the state’s Wage Transparency Act, the range for this position is $26.33 - $27.33 per hour.
